Beach volleyball is a classic and a real crowd-pleaser. It combines the thrill of competition with the joy of being outdoors, making it a favorite for many beachgoers. All you need is a net, a ball, and some enthusiastic players. It’s perfect for groups and is a great way to work up a sweat while having fun. Plus, diving in the sand to make that epic save? Priceless.

Setting Up Your Game

Setting up a game of beach volleyball is straightforward, which adds to its appeal. The first step is to find a suitable area on the beach that is flat and spacious enough for a court. You can use a portable net or improvise with a rope tied between two sturdy poles. Make sure the sand is free of debris to ensure safety during play.

Rules and Strategies

Understanding the basic rules of beach volleyball can enhance your playing experience. Typically, the game is played with two teams of two players each, but more players can join if space allows. The objective is to score points by getting the ball to land on the opposing team’s side of the court. Developing strategies, such as effective communication and positioning, can give your team a competitive edge.

The Health Benefits

Beach volleyball is not just about fun; it’s also a great workout. The uneven surface of the sand adds resistance, making it more challenging and beneficial for muscle strengthening. Playing volleyball enhances agility, balance, and coordination, and the social aspect of the game can boost your mood and reduce stress levels.

2. Sandcastle Building Contest

Who doesn’t love a good sandcastle? This game taps into creativity and teamwork, making it perfect for kids and adults alike. Challenge your friends or family to see who can build the most creative or elaborate sand structure, and let your imagination run wild.

Tools of the Trade

To build the perfect sandcastle, having the right tools can make all the difference. Buckets and shovels are essential for shaping and transporting sand. However, don’t overlook the usefulness of smaller tools like spades and even kitchen utensils for finer details. Incorporating natural materials such as shells and seaweed can add a decorative touch.

Techniques for Success

Building a sturdy sandcastle requires understanding the properties of sand. Wet sand is key to creating strong, lasting structures. Start with a solid base and gradually build up, packing the sand tightly as you go. Carving out details takes patience, so take your time to craft your masterpiece.

Judging and Themes

If you’re hosting a contest, consider setting themes to inspire creativity, such as castles from different cultures or famous landmarks. Judging criteria can include creativity, complexity, and structural integrity. This not only adds a competitive edge but also encourages participants to explore new ideas and techniques.

3. Beach Frisbee

Frisbee is another beach staple that promises hours of fun. It’s a versatile game that can be as relaxed or competitive as you like, and it’s easy to pick up, requiring minimal equipment. It can be played in pairs or teams, making it a flexible choice for any group size.

Basic Throwing Techniques

Mastering the basic frisbee throw is essential for a successful game. The backhand throw is the most common and easiest to learn, but experimenting with forehand throws and the hammer can add variety to your play. Practice makes perfect, and soon you’ll be throwing like a pro.

Variations and Challenges

To add excitement to your frisbee game, consider introducing variations. Ultimate frisbee, for instance, incorporates elements of soccer and football, creating a dynamic and fast-paced game. Setting up goals and creating rules for scoring can turn a casual toss into a thrilling competition.

Safety and Etiquette

While frisbee is generally a safe game, it’s important to be mindful of your surroundings. Ensure that your playing area is clear of obstacles and other beachgoers. Practicing good etiquette, such as calling out to signal a catch or pass, ensures a smooth and enjoyable game for everyone involved.

4. Tug of War

Gather a group and get ready for a test of strength and teamwork with tug of war. It’s a simple game that can get hilariously intense, and it’s perfect for bringing people together through friendly competition.

Preparing for the Game

Before starting a game of tug of war, it’s crucial to find a sturdy rope that can withstand the force of both teams pulling. Ensure that the playing area is free from hazards and that the sand provides a good grip for players’ feet. Safety should always be a priority to prevent injuries.

Team Strategies

Winning at tug of war requires more than just brute strength; it’s about strategy and coordination. Teams should position their strongest members at the back for maximum leverage. Synchronizing pulls and maintaining a steady rhythm can make a significant difference in overpowering the opposing team.

Celebrating Victories

After an intense match, celebrating with your team is part of the fun. Whether you win or lose, the camaraderie and laughter shared during the game create lasting memories. Consider organizing multiple rounds or a tournament to keep the excitement going throughout the day.

5. Beach Soccer

Transform the beach into your soccer field. Beach soccer is a fantastic way to improve your skills and get some cardio in while having fun. The soft sand adds a new level of challenge, enhancing the overall experience.

Setting Up Your Field

Creating a beach soccer field is simple and requires minimal equipment. Use cones, towels, or any available markers to outline the goals and boundaries. Ensure the area is free of debris, and the sand is even for safe play. Adjust the field size based on the number of players and their skill levels.

Rules and Modifications

Beach soccer follows the basic rules of traditional soccer, but with a few modifications to suit the sandy environment. Teams can have fewer players, and the game can be shorter to accommodate the physical demands of playing on sand. Encourage creativity with moves and shots, as the sand allows for unique plays.

Fitness and Fun

Playing soccer on the beach offers a fantastic workout, as the sand increases resistance and challenges your muscles differently than playing on grass. It improves endurance, balance, and coordination while providing a fun and competitive way to enjoy the beach. Plus, it’s a great opportunity to bond with friends and family through shared goals and teamwork.

6. Paddleball

Paddleball is perfect if you’re looking for a game that requires a bit more skill and concentration. It’s a great way to improve hand-eye coordination and have fun at the same time, making it a favorite for beach enthusiasts.

Equipment and Setup

All you need for a game of paddleball are paddles and a small rubber ball. These are often sold in sets at beach stores, making them easy to acquire. Choose a spot on the beach with enough space to move freely without disturbing others, and you’re ready to go.

Improving Your Game

To excel in paddleball, practice is key. Start with simple rallies, focusing on maintaining control and accuracy. Gradually increase the difficulty by adding spin or aiming for longer rallies. Playing with different partners can also help you adapt to various playing styles and improve your skills.

Competitive Play

For those who enjoy a challenge, organizing paddleball tournaments can add a competitive edge to the game. Set rules for scoring and match length, and invite friends to participate. The thrill of competition combined with the beach setting creates a lively and enjoyable atmosphere.

7. Limbo

Limbo is a fantastic game for beach parties. It’s all about flexibility and fun, and it’s sure to bring out some laughs. This game is simple to set up and can be enjoyed by participants of all ages.

Setting the Stage

To set up a game of limbo, all you need is a stick or rope to serve as the limbo bar. Choose a spot on the beach with ample space for participants to move freely. Play some lively music to set the mood and encourage everyone to join in the fun.

Techniques and Tips

The key to mastering limbo is maintaining a low center of gravity and flexibility. Bend backward and move smoothly under the bar without touching it. Participants should keep their knees bent and use their arms for balance. With practice, you’ll find yourself getting lower with each round.

Creating a Party Atmosphere

Limbo is more than just a game; it’s a way to enhance the social aspect of your beach day. Encourage spectators to cheer and motivate participants, creating an energetic and supportive environment. As the bar gets lower, the excitement builds, making for unforgettable moments and lots of laughter.

8. Beach Bocce Ball

This is a relaxing yet competitive game that’s easy to learn and play. Beach bocce ball is perfect for all ages and skill levels, making it an inclusive option for family gatherings or friendly competitions.

Game Setup and Equipment

To play bocce ball on the beach, you’ll need a set of bocce balls and a smaller ball known as the pallino. Find a flat area on the sand to serve as the playing field. The objective is to throw your bocce balls as close to the pallino as possible, scoring points based on proximity.

Techniques for Success

While bocce ball is simple to learn, mastering the game requires skill and strategy. Focus on your throwing technique, aiming for accuracy rather than distance. Consider the sand’s texture and how it affects the ball’s roll. Developing a strategy for blocking opponents’ balls can also improve your chances of winning.

Social and Relaxing

Beach bocce ball is not just about competition; it’s also a great way to relax and socialize. The game’s pace allows for conversation and interaction between turns, making it a perfect choice for leisurely beach days. Whether you’re playing with family or friends, bocce ball fosters a sense of community and fun.

9. Capture the Flag

For a game that involves strategy and teamwork, try capture the flag. It’s best played with a large group and is sure to get everyone involved. This classic game combines elements of stealth, speed, and cunning.

Organizing Your Teams

Divide players into two teams, each with its own territory marked on the sand. Each team hides a flag within its territory, and the goal is to capture the opposing team’s flag and bring it back to your side. Ensure teams are balanced in terms of skill and numbers to keep the game fair and fun.

Strategy and Tactics

Success in capture the flag depends on effective strategy and teamwork. Assign roles to team members, such as defenders and attackers, to maximize efficiency. Communication is crucial for coordinating movements and spotting opponents. Adapt your tactics based on the flow of the game to stay one step ahead.

Building Team Spirit

Capture the flag is more than just a game; it’s an opportunity to build team spirit and camaraderie. Encourage players to support and cheer for each other, creating a positive and inclusive atmosphere. The shared excitement and teamwork foster a sense of unity and can lead to lasting friendships.

10. Water Balloon Toss

Water balloon toss is a refreshing way to cool down and have a good laugh. It’s simple, fun, and perfect for a hot day. This game is ideal for all ages and provides a lighthearted way to enjoy the beach.

Preparation and Setup

Prepare for a water balloon toss by filling up a batch of water balloons in advance. Ensure you have enough for multiple rounds to keep the fun going. Pair up participants and have them stand facing each other, starting at a close distance to practice their catching skills.

Increasing the Challenge

As the game progresses, increase the challenge by having partners take a step back after each successful catch. The distance adds excitement and tests the participants’ coordination and reflexes. The unpredictability of water balloons adds an element of surprise, resulting in lots of laughter and enjoyment.

Cooling Off and Having Fun

Water balloon toss is not just a game; it’s a delightful way to cool off on a hot day. The refreshing splash of water provides relief from the sun, while the friendly competition brings smiles to everyone’s faces. It’s a simple yet effective way to enhance your beach experience with joy and laughter.
